Fire ring not completely flush with WG, is this ok?
 
2 Attachment(s)
Like the title says, the fire ring doesn't look flush with the wg... but after add the gasket, will this be okay? I would say the the gap is like 1-2 mm.

My used Tial looks exactly like that. It was used for 1500 miles... I'd assume its fine :p

I believe it'll push up properly when you clamp it all down. It has to fight against the Valve which is being forced down by the wg springs.

When I first got my wastegate I was worried about the same thing. When the wastegate isn't on the manifold the spring is completely extended. The valve seal/fire ring needs to be compressed for an airtight seal and to compress the spring slightly.
